The Week in Winners: $1 Million Scratch-Off Sold in Windsor Mill is Top Maryland Lottery Prize of the Week

A Baltimore resident claimed the past week’s biggest Maryland Lottery win, as a Triple Red 777s scratch-off ticket sold in Windsor Mill delivered a $1 million top prize.

Meanwhile, a $182,263 FAST PLAY progressive jackpot Home Run Riches Walk-off Winnings ticket was sold in Parkton; a Charles County resident won $110,000 when THE BIG SPIN scratch-off ticket earned him a chance at the Big Spin Wheel; a $77,777 winning Triple Red 7s Multiplier scratch-off ticket was sold in Cumberland; and Powerball player in Beltsville won $50,000.

Statewide, the Lottery paid nearly $30 million in prizes from June 29-July 5, including 22 winning tickets that were worth $10,000 or more.

Winners are encouraged to sign the backs of tickets and keep winning tickets in a safe location. Tickets for draw games expire 182 days after the drawing date. FAST PLAY tickets expire 182 days after purchase. The last dates to claim for scratch-off tickets are posted on the scratch-offs page at mdlottery.com.

Winners of prizes larger than $25,000 must redeem tickets at the Maryland Lottery Customer Resource Center in Baltimore, which is open by appointment only. Prizes up to $25,000 can be claimed at the cashier window of any of the six casinos in Maryland. Prizes up to $5,000 can be claimed at any of more than 400 Expanded Cashing Authority Program (XCAP) locations. All Maryland Lottery retailers are authorized to redeem tickets worth up to and including $600. More information is available on the How to Claim page of the Lottery website.

Since its inception in 1973, the Maryland Lottery has awarded more than $35.5 billion in prizes to Lottery players and contributed more than $20.7 billion to the State of Maryland. One of Maryland’s largest revenue sources, the Lottery supports important state programs and services including education and public health initiatives. For more information, go to mdlottery.com.
